The Charge 2 is a faulty design. 
So many have failed and Fitbit do not do anything other than offer a small discount if you're out of warranty. Poor design has lead to these device failures. 
Sweat creeps inside the device and causes the screen failures. 
This is a device designed for exercise! 
Fitbit sent me the standard 25% off email when my second device died just outside warranty. 
The first Charge 2 died inside warranty. 

I replied explaining how they had a faulty device from new and as such they have responsibilities to their consumers, but they just ignored my email. 

Buy Garmin, they offer a 70% discount on any Garmin product if your's fails outside warranty, for life. 
That's customer service and belief in your products.
